Why Quiet Philanthropy is Clover’s Choice

 

In the realm of philanthropy, the approach to giving often varies widely among individuals and organizations. While some prefer grand gestures and public displays of generosity, others opt for a quieter, more understated approach. Clover, a prominent figure in the world of philanthropy, has embraced the ethos of quiet giving with fervor and conviction. Here's why quiet philanthropy stands as Clover's choice:

1. Impact Over Attention

For Clover, the primary focus of philanthropy lies in making a tangible difference in the lives of those in need. By choosing quiet philanthropy, Clover ensures that every dollar spent goes towards effecting positive change, rather than towards publicity.

2. Humility and Integrity

Quiet philanthropy reflects Clover's values of humility and integrity. Rather than seeking accolades or praise, Clover remains committed to the underlying principles of giving back to society without expecting anything in return. By operating with humility, Clover sets an example for others to follow, emphasizing the importance of sincerity and genuine concern for the well-being of others.

3. Long-Term Sustainability

Quiet philanthropy enables Clover to focus on long-term sustainability and systemic change. By avoiding the allure of immediate gratification or short-term publicity, Clover invests in initiatives and organizations that address root causes and create lasting solutions to complex societal issues. This strategic approach ensures that the impact of Clover's philanthropy extends far beyond the present moment, shaping a better future for generations to come.

4. Respect for Privacy

Respecting the privacy of beneficiaries and partners is paramount in Clover's approach to philanthropy. By choosing to operate quietly, Clover protects the dignity and autonomy of those they seek to serve, allowing individuals and communities to retain their sense of agency and self-respect. This commitment to privacy fosters trust and strengthens relationships, paving the way for meaningful collaboration and sustainable change.

5. Leading by Example

Through their commitment to quiet philanthropy, Clover leads by example, inspiring others to embrace a similar ethos of giving with purpose and humility. By demonstrating that philanthropy is not defined by grand gestures or public acclaim, but rather by the sincerity of one's intentions and the impact of one's actions, Clover ignites a ripple effect of generosity and compassion throughout society.
